A dramatic stoppage-time equaliser from Fulwood Amateurs substitute Glenn Steele earned his side a last gasp 2-2 draw and denied Daisy their first league win of the season.
Steele’s goal topped an amazing late comeback for ten man Fulwood against a Daisy side who were two goals up thanks to a Liam Sheppard double, but in the end had to settle for a share of the points.
It was a game that burst into life in the second half, after an opening 45 minutes that saw both sides largely cancel one another out, with clear chances few and far between.
The nearest to a goal came on 28 minutes, when Fulwood’s leading scorer Spencer Lucas found the back of the net with a shot from the edge of the box, but the goal was ruled out by the flag of the assistant referee.
However, the second half got off to an explosive start when Daisy took the lead inside the opening minute.
The architect of the goal was Joao Soares, whose driving run into the box ended with a shot that was blocked, but the ball fell neatly into the path of Sheppard, who pounced to fire into the far corner of the net.
